IOT Space Managment

Over view

IoT Space Management uses connected sensors, cloud platforms, and real-time analytics to monitor and optimize how physical spaces are used—whether offices, retail stores, factories, or public facilities. It helps businesses reduce waste, improve comfort, and make data-driven decisions about layout, occupancy, and resource allocation.

It provides real-time insights into:

Occupancy (who/what is using the space)
Utilization (how often and how well it is used)
Movement patterns
Environmental conditions
Asset tracking and location data

Key Components of IoT Space Management

IoT Sensors

IoT space management relies on occupancy sensors, BLE/UWB beacons, CO₂/environment sensors, people-counting cameras/counters, desk/room sensors, and parking sensors for real-time monitoring.

Connectivity

It connects using Zigbee, BLE, NB-IoT/LTE-M, Wi-Fi, and LoRaWAN depending on range, power usage, and cost.
